Tony Peake: North Facing (In Conversation with Judith Krummeck)


Join us at Bird in Hand, our sibling shop, for a very special evening with author Tony Peake, in town from the UK to celebrate his new novel, North FacingThe beloved local writer Judith Krummeck will join Peake in conversation.

A novel of awakening and atonement, North Facing is an exquisitely realised story that revisits a seminal boyhood moment as it plays out -- with unexpected and sinister consequences -- against the backdrop of political upheaval in South Africa.

Tony Peake is a novelist, short story writer, biographer, and sometime literary agent, notably for Booker Prize-winner, Damon Galgut. He has written three novels—A Summer TideSon to the Father, and North Facing—and a biography of the film director and author, Derek Jarman. Tony edited a collection of short stories on the theme of Seduction, and his own short stories have been included in a variety of anthologies. He was born in South Africa, but has spent his adult life in the UK, either in London or in north east Essex where he lives with his civil partner and fellow South African, Peter Cartwright. 

Judith Krummeck is a writer, broadcaster, and immigrant living in Baltimore. She is the evening drive time host for Maryland’s classical music station, WBJC, 91.5 FM, and she is the author of two books—a memoir in essays, Beyond the Baobab, and a biographical memoir, Old New Worlds. Her screenplay adaptation of André Brink’s final novel, Philida, is currently in development in South Africa. Judith holds an MFA in Creative Writing & Publishing Arts from the University of Baltimore. Her work has appeared in publications such as The Rumpus, Atticus Review, Past Ten, Monkeybicycle, and Baltimore Fishbowl.
